Colon Cancer Diagnosis: Two Major Tests And The Other Staging Tests

Colon cancer diagnosis may be the same as those of the examinations done with other colon problems. You have to undergo these tests to let you know the real score behind the disease. There are major tests which could be made while staging tests could also be conducted.

Colon cancer may not have a definite symptom associated to its occurrence.  The manifestations are unusual since they are relatively the same with those felt with other digestive tract diseases.  However, there are tests which could be done to help detect whether you are already a victim of the disease.

Major tests for colon cancer diagnosis

Doctor and patient with an x-rayLocalizing or preventing the spread of tumors in the colon could be done through a series of tests.  It may also confirm the symptoms you are feeling.  You actually have two options to determine whether you have colon cancer or not and they are:

1. Barium enema x-rays.  Also known as the lower GI series (GI means gastrointestinal), barium enema actually asks you to undergo a series of x-rays.  The colon and the rectum are examined under the x-ray machine after you have taken enema.  The enema used is not a simple water-based solution or the coffee enema for colon cleansing.  This test uses enema which have been extracted from a clear and crumbly fluid which has barium in it.  The indications that you have colon cancer are shown by the barium as it draws the large intestines on the x-ray plates.  The dark shadows found on the background are manifestations of tumors and other intestinal abnormalities.

2. Colonoscopy.  This procedure involves insertion of a long and flexible tube inside the rectum.  This is done to give your doctors a clearer picture of what is found inside your colon.  This is said to be better than barium x-rays since it could detect even the smallest polyps that could occur within the organ.  What makes it even more favorable than the first step is that the colonoscope could help in the removal of the polyps which will later on be turned over to the pathologist.  This will help the latter assess whether the polyps has cancer cells in it. 

The staging tests for colon cancer

Should the samples taken from the colonoscope or the results found from barium x-rays show that you have colon cancer, biopsies could be taken.  This is a procedure wherein a sample of a tissue is removed for further laboratory examination.  They are tested under the microscope to confirm the result given by the diagnosis.

After confirmation given by the biopsy outcome, staging tests are necessary.  This will help detect whether the cancer cells have divided and reached other organs of the body.  It is a fact that colon cancer may affect the lungs and the liver thus a series of examinations should again be conducted.

You could be recommended for chest x-rays, ultrasound (ultrasonography), or the so-called CAT scan.  These procedures could help distinguish any cancer spread in the abdomen, liver and lungs.  In some instances, your doctor may also require blood tests for carcinoembyonic antigen (CEA).  This is a substance which comes from the emergence of cancer cells.  This is an ultimate test which could help rule out or intensify the truth behind the spread of colorectal cancer.
